Marble Institute Of America! link] I personally do not advocate using Marble, Travertine and other natural stone in showers or wet areas because it is too soft and hard to maintain. I built this shower recently and all the tile looks like marble but it really is Porcelain and manufacturers copy natural stone for a reason.

The recent boom in the housing market is a boon to the natural stone category. The flooring industry in general, and the natural stone category in particular, is starting to reap the benefits of such activities. Of all surfacing types, natural stone also has the ability to increase resale value of a home due to its classic aesthetics.
